Nvidia and SK Group put a $500bn umbrella over chips, memory and a 2GW AI campus, but the first useful number is still missing: how much capacity is actually under contract

Nvidia and SK Group announced a $500bn AI partnership covering memory, systems and a Korean AI campus. The disclosed plan includes long-term HBM4 supply and a 2GW South Korean datacentre built around Vera Rubin, with initial service targeted for 2027, but no binding first-phase order, named site or power schedule. The edition separates aggregate ambition from contracted capacity, then follows the constraint through a 3.1GW synchronized datacentre disconnection, Google's Pixel 11 price increase during the memory shortage, Shopify's 93% reduction in theme code, and the argument that open-weight AI is approaching its Kubernetes layer.
